Atmospheric deposition is an important way for nitrogen input to the biosphere.In recent decades,the emission of nitrogen compounds from fossil fuel combustion and fertilizer application has increased dramatically.The ecological problems affected by nitrogen deposition have increased prominently.Nitrogen deposition has been one of the hotspots in the research area of biogeochemical cycle.In contrast to other ecosystems,the research on nitrogen deposition under the special surface condition of reservoir is rarely reported in the literature.Danjiangkou Reservoir is the water source of the Middle Line of the South-to-North Water Transfer Project.TDN concentration of the reservoir water was over class V of water quality.Under the condition that the non-point source pollution around the reservoir has been controlled,atmospheric nitrogen deposition may be the important way for nitrogen input to the reservoir.To test this conjecture,we conducted an experiment of nitrogen deposition on Danjiangkou Reservoir.The study sites was located in Xichuan part of Danjiangkou Reservoir.Sampling sites were set around the Xiaotaipingyang waters which is the core area of Xichuan part.Field observation,field investigation and indoor analysis were used to systematically study the dry,wet and total nitrogen deposition flux in Danjiangkou Reservoir.The results revealed the contribution of nitrogen deposition to the exogenous nitrogen input to the reservoir,clarifying the composition characters of nitrogen deposition,and preliminarily demonstrated the origin and variation laws of nitrogen deposition.On the basis,the measures for controlling nitrogen pollution of the reservoir were explored.The results showed that:The flux of total dissolved nitrogen?TDN?in Danjiangkou Reservoir was 39.55kg/hm2·a which means TDN was an important external nitrogen input source of the reservoir.The wet deposition flux of TDN was 18.06 kg/hm2·a,and the dry deposition flux was 21.49 kg/hm2·a.In the study period,the concentration of TDN wet deposition began to rise in September which reached its peak in January or March,and then declined.The dry deposition flux of TDN increased from December to July,and then declined.Land use types had a significant impact on TDN wet deposition concentration and TDN dry deposition flux in Danjiangkou Reservoir.Ammonia nitrogen?NH4+-N?,nitrate nitrogen?NO3--N?and soluble organic nitrogen?DON?were important nitrogen deposition forms in Danjiangkou Reservoir.Their deposition flux was 17.62 kg/hm2·a,13.56 kg/hm2·a and 8.44 kg/hm2·a,respectively.The dry deposition flux of NH4+-N was 8.04 kg/hm2·a,the wet deposition flux was 10.58 kg/hm2·a,of which the highest wet deposition flux happed from April to September,accounting for 71.5%of the annual input.The dry deposition flux of NO3--N was 8.71 kg/hm2·a,the wet deposition flux was 4.85 kg/hm2·a,of which the highest wet deposition flux happed from April to July,accounting for 54.75%of the annual input.The dry deposition flux of DON was 4.74 kg/hm2·a and the wet deposition flux was 3.64 kg/hm2·a,of which the highest wet deposition flux happed from April to September,accounting for 82.54%of the annual input.Land use types had a significant impact on the wet deposition concentration of NH4+-N and the dry deposition flux of NO3--N in Danjiangkou Reservoir area.TDN deposition flux accounted for 0.24 times of the total nitrogen input to the reservoir and the potential threat to reservoir water quality cannot be ignored.The annual total deposition flux of NH4+-N was 1.47 times greater than the riverine input to the reservoir.NH4+-N/NO3--N in dry and wet deposition was in the same trend with agricultural fertilization activities around the reservoir.The analysis of NH4+-N/NO3--N ratio shows that NH4+-N was the most important form of nitrogen deposition in Danjiangkou Reservoir from 2015 to 2016.NH4+-N and NO3--N were both important of nitrogen deposition in Danjiangkou Reservoir from 2016 to 2017.The analysis of?15N indicated that the main source of NH4+-N deposition to the reservoir is agricultural fertilization,the main source of NO3--N deposition was the emissions of thermal power plants and automobiles.Under the condition of non-point source pollution being controlled,nitrogen deposition flux contributes greatly to the input of exogenous nitrogen in Danjiangkou Reservoir which is a problem that must be solved for water quality protection.The main compounds of nitrogen deposition in Danjiangkou Reservoir are NH4+-N and NO3--N.The main sources of NH4+-N deposition are automobile exhaust and coal-fired emission from thermal power plants.The results can provide an empirical basis for exploring the nitrogen deposition flux and characteristics under the unique surface conditions of reservoirs,provide data supporting for evaluating the contribution of deposition to reservoirs'external nitrogen input,and provide a scientific basis for the selection of water quality management measures of reservoirs in China.
